1. Benefits of Trex Decking: Durability, Low Maintenance and Eco-Friendliness
Opting for Trex decking installation in Horsham has numerous advantages, making it an increasingly popular choice among homeowners. Some key benefits include:
– Durability: Known for its resilience against harsh weather, mold, insects, and fading, Trex decking outperforms traditional wood in longevity. It’s designed to withstand heavy foot traffic providing a pristine appearance that doesn’t suffer from the splintering or warping common in natural timber.
– Low Maintenance: Trex decking requires minimal upkeep, eliminating the need for laborious tasks like sanding, staining, or painting. This frees you from the endless cycle of weekend chores, allowing you to spend your time enjoying the space rather than exhausting yourself with its upkeep. An occasional cleaning with soap and water is enough to keep it looking vibrant and new.
– Eco-Friendly: Made of 95% recycled materials, including reclaimed wood and recycled plastic, Trex decking is an eco-conscious choice for environmentally responsible homeowners, helping reduce landfill waste and deforestation. 2. Trex Deck Design Options: Color, Profile, and Installation Flexibility
Achieve a truly unique and personalized deck design by exploring the variety of design options available with Trex decking:
– Color Options: Trex decking comes in an extensive range of colors, allowing you to create a deck that complements your home’s exterior and personal design preferences. From warm, earthy tones to bold, contemporary hues, there’s a color choice to suit every aesthetic. The multi-tonal streaking in the high-end lines provides a depth of color that mimics exotic hardwoods like Ipe or Mahogany.
– Board Profiles: Select from various board profiles, such as grooved or square edge, to achieve your desired installation method and appearance. Grooved boards allow for hidden fasteners, creating a seamless look, while square-edge boards offer a more traditional, visible fastener appearance. Square-edge boards are also perfect for “picture framing” your deck, adding a sophisticated border that defines the space.
– Installation Methods: Choose from a range of installation methods, whether you prefer a standard, diagonal, or unique herringbone pattern. 3. Customization and Accessories: Elevate Your Trex Deck and Outdoor Space
Further enhance your Trex deck and outdoor living space with various customization options and accessories:
– Railing Systems: Complete your deck design with a stylish and functional Trex railing system. Offering various styles, colors, and materials designed to complement your Trex decking, these railings add both safety and visual appeal to your outdoor space. Mixing materials, such as black aluminum balusters with composite posts, can create a modern, high-contrast look that frames your backyard view.
– Lighting: Incorporate integrated lighting features, such as in-deck lights, riser lights, or post cap lights, to enhance safety and ambiance. These subtle glowing elements transform your deck into a nighttime oasis, extending your usability long after the sun goes down.
– Furniture: Complement your Trex deck with comfortable and stylish furniture made from weather-resistant materials. Choose from various seating options, tables, and unique furnishings designed to blend seamlessly with your decking and suit your entertainment needs. 4. Maintenance Tips and Best Practices: Ensuring Longevity and Pristine Appearance
Maintain the pristine appearance of your Trex deck and ensure its longevity with the following care and maintenance tips:
– Regular Cleaning: Keep your Trex deck clean by sweeping away debris, leaves, and dirt regularly. This helps prevent the buildup of organic materials, reducing the risk of mold and mildew growth. Clearing the gaps between boards is also essential to allow for proper water drainage and airflow.
– Mild Soap and Water: Gently clean your Trex deck using a soft-bristle brush, mild soap, and water to remove dirt or spills. Avoid using harsh chemicals or overly abrasive cleaning tools to ensure the material’s integrity and appearance.
– Proper Ventilation: Ensure adequate ventilation below your Trex deck to prevent the accumulation of moisture, which can lead to mold growth or other issues over time.
